Setting Up Email Ingestion Integration in Everbridge 360™.
Description
Email ingestion enables integration between Everbridge Suite and third-party alerting applications such as event monitoring tools, digital signage software, and CAD systems. Incoming emails are parsed and used to automatically launch incidents based on defined criteria.
The following requirements apply to email ingestion configuration:
- Incoming emails must be formatted as plain text
- Approved sender domain or wildcard format is required (for example, "*@yourdomain.com")
- Unrestricted sender domains are not supported
- API access must be enabled for the organization
Processing Behavior
HTML emails are converted to plain text with all HTML tags removed, smart characters are converted to standard characters, and email delivery and processing may introduce latency before incident creation.
Note: If no conditions are defined in the filtering criteria, all emails that meet the base sender and recipient rules will trigger an incident.
Testing and Validation
Test emails should be sent after configuration to confirm successful ingestion and incident creation. Use variable testing tools to validate mappings and parsing behavior before production use.
